The Tunisia Agricultural Pumps Market is experiencing steady growth driven by increasing demand for efficient irrigation systems in the agriculture sector. Farmers are adopting modern pumping technologies to improve water efficiency and crop yields. The market is characterized by a wide range of pump types including centrifugal, submersible, and diaphragm pumps, with electric pumps being the most popular choice. Key players in the market are focusing on product innovation and customization to cater to the diverse needs of farmers across different regions of Tunisia. Government initiatives promoting sustainable agricultural practices and water conservation are also driving the market growth. Overall, the Tunisia Agricultural Pumps Market is poised for continued expansion in the coming years as agriculture remains a vital sector for the country`s economy.

In the Tunisia Agricultural Pumps Market, some challenges faced include limited access to financing for farmers to invest in high-quality pumps, inadequate infrastructure leading to difficulties in product distribution and after-sales services, and a lack of awareness about the benefits of advanced agricultural pumps among smallholder farmers. Additionally, the market faces pressure from cheaper imported pumps, which can hinder the growth of domestic pump manufacturers. Furthermore, issues such as water scarcity, fluctuating energy prices, and changing weather patterns pose challenges to the efficiency and effectiveness of agricultural pumps in Tunisia. Overcoming these challenges will require targeted investment in rural infrastructure, increased access to finance for farmers, and awareness campaigns to promote the adoption of modern agricultural pump technologies.

In Tunisia, government policies related to the agricultural pumps market aim to support and promote the modernization and efficiency of the agriculture sector. The government has implemented various initiatives to provide subsidies and incentives for farmers to invest in high-quality and energy-efficient agricultural pumps. Additionally, there are regulations in place to ensure the proper use and maintenance of pumps to conserve water resources and promote sustainable agricultural practices. The government also supports research and development efforts to introduce innovative technologies in the sector. Overall, the policies emphasize the importance of enhancing productivity, reducing environmental impact, and improving the overall competitiveness of the agriculture industry in Tunisia.
